Faye Counts Wiley “Titter” was born on June 11, 1932 in Many, LA and went to be with her husband and daughter and their Lord and Savior on July 10, 2023, at the age of 91. She graduated from Many High School. Faye was a devoted home maker, wife, and loving mother of two children, Robert Lee Wiley, and Janie Faye Wiley. She embraced her time with family and treasured her role as wife, mother, grandmother, great-grandmother, great-great grandmother, and aunt. She enjoyed being outside in her yard piddling, keeping an immaculate house, raking/burning piles in Zwolle, and watching the birds at the feeder in her backyard. She found joy in cooking homemade biscuits and chocolate gravy (or passing out candies) for her family (especially for grandkids). She had an infectious laugh and loved to cut up and reminisce about the old days. We were blessed to have her in our lives, and she will be forever cherished.
